Ingredients You’ll Need

Every ingredient in this Healthy Banana Bread Recipe plays a vital role, from the hearty whole wheat flour providing texture and fiber, to the mashed bananas that bring natural sweetness and moisture. These essentials come together to create a loaf that’s as delicious as it is wholesome.

  • 2 cups whole wheat flour: This adds a nutty flavor and healthy fiber; spoon and level it for accuracy or weigh out 230g.
  • 1 ½ teaspoons baking powder: Helps your bread rise beautifully and stay light.
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da: Works with the acidic elements to ensure perfect leavening.
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on: Adds warm spice notes; you can also sprinkle in nutmeg and ground cloves for extra depth.
  • ¼ teaspoon salt: Balances the sweetness and enhances all the other flavors.
  • 1.5 cups mashed banana: The star ingredient for moisture and natural sweetness—be sure to mash until very smooth.
  • ⅓ cup oil or melted butter: Ghee or coconut oil are excellent options that lend richness without overpowering.
  • ½ cup mild honey or maple syrup: A wholesome natural sweetener that adds just the right touch of sweetness.
  • 2 large eggs: Provide structure and bind everything together.
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: A small addition that brings out the warm flavors beautifully.

How to Make Healthy Banana Bread Recipe

Step 1: Preparing to Bake

Start by setting your oven to 350°F (175°C) so it’s ready to go when your batter is mixed. Line a 5×9-inch loaf pan with parchment paper, leaving a little overhang on the sides; this clever trick makes removing your bread a breeze and keeps it looking flawless.

Step 2: Mixing the Dry Ingredients

In a medium bowl, whisk together the whole wheat flour,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t. This evenly distributes your leaveners and spices for a consistent flavor and texture across every slice.

Step 3: Preparing the Wet Ingredients

Grab your ripest bananas and mash them until perfectly smooth—no chunky bits here! Then add the oil or melted butter, honey (or maple syrup), eggs, and vanilla extract. Whisk it all together until the mixture is glossy and well combined, promising a silky batter.

Step 4: Combining Wet and Dry

Gently fold the dry ingredients into the wet using a spatula. This is where patience counts—mix just until you don’t see pockets of flour anymore. Leaving a few small lumps is totally fine and actually helps keep your bread tender and moist.

Step 5: Baking Your Bread

Pour the batter into your prepared pan and smooth the surface for an even rise. Bake for 45 to 55 minutes until the center is set and a toothpick inserted comes out clean. Let the bread cool in the pan for 10 minutes before lifting it out with the parchment paper. Allow it to rest on a rack for another 20 to 30 minutes before slicing—this resting time ensures each slice holds together beautifully.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Once your Healthy Banana Bread Recipe has cooled completely,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or store it in an airtight container. It will stay fresh at room temperature for up to three days—perfect for quick grab-and-go breakfasts or snacks.

Freezing

This banana bread freezes remarkably well. Slice it first, then wrap slices individually or together in foil and place in a freezer bag. You’ll find that frozen slices keep well for up to three months without losing their delicious texture.

Reheating

To bring that fresh-from-the-oven warmth back, pop frozen slices straight into the toaster or warm them gently in the oven at 300°F for about 10 minutes. This quick reheating revives softness and the lovely aroma of your Healthy Banana Bread Recipe.

FAQs

Can I use all-purpose flour instead of whole wheat?

Absolutely! Swapping with all-purpose flour will make the bread a bit lighter in texture, but whole wheat flour provides extra fiber and a nuttier taste that really compliments the bananas.

What can I substitute for eggs if I’m vegan or allergic?

You can try flax eggs made by mixing 1 tablespoon of ground flaxseed with 3 tablespoons of water per egg. Let it sit until gel-like, then use it just like eggs in this recipe.

Is it necessary to use ripe bananas?

Yes, very ripe bananas are key because they’re sweeter and softer, which adds natural sweetness and keeps your bread moist without needing too much extra sugar or fat.

Can I add nuts or chocolate chips?

Definitely! Adding a half cup of chopped walnuts, pecans, or dark chocolate chips into the batter before baking adds a delightful crunch or melty surprise to each bite.

How do I know when the banana bread is done?

The best test is inserting a toothpick or skewer into the center—if it comes out clean or with just a few moist crumbs, your bread is perfectly baked and ready to enjoy.

Ingredients

Scale

Dry Ingredients

  • 2 cups whole wheat flour (fluffed, spooned and leveled; or weigh out 230g)
  • 1 ½ teaspoons ba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¼ teaspoon salt

Wet Ingredients

  • 1.5 cups mashed banana
  • ⅓ cup oil or melted butter (ghee or coconut oil recommended)
  • ½ cup mild honey (or maple syrup)
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ract


Instructions

  1. Prep: Heat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a 5×9-inch loaf pan with parchment paper, leaving an overhang for easy removal later. Gather all the ingredients to streamline the baking process.
  2.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ium bowl, whisk together the whole wheat flour, baking powder, baking soda, ground cinnamon, and salt until evenly combined.
  3. Prepare Wet Ingredients: In a large measuring jug or bowl, thoroughly mash the bananas until smooth with no large chunks. Whisk in the oil (or melted butter), honey (or maple syrup), eggs, and vanilla extract until the mixture is glossy and well blended.
  4. Combine Batter: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ients. Gently fold using a spatula just until the dry flour disappears with a few small lumps remaining, which is preferable to avoid overmixing. Transfer the batter into the prepared loaf pan and smooth the top evenly.
  5. Bake: Place the pan in the preheated oven and bake for 45–55 minutes. Check doneness by inserting a tester or toothpick into the center; it should come out clean. Once baked, allow the bread to c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then lift it out using the parchment overhang and transfer onto a cooling rack. Let it cool for another 20–30 minutes before slicing to maintain texture and flavor.

Notes

  • Fluffing and spooning the flour before measuring ensures accurate measurement and a lighter texture in the final bread.
  • Mashing bananas thoroughly helps achieve a smooth, moist bread without large banana chunks disrupting the texture.
  • Do not overmix the batter to prevent a dense bread; small lumps in the batter are ideal.
  • Check the bread starting at 45 minutes to avoid overbaking, which can dry the bread out.
  • Cooling the bread properly before slicing helps the bread set and retains moisture.
